Output 7b8c6b500aebc20254d9fc1a504d672e01046bf9893ca9da6d9e8f99a4017d3f:68

value
2698285
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d445f764e31e990df0c6afd8e59e670d3d48ef31 OP_EQUAL
address
3M3QzZWZwjE7N2RtVHGZ4JTKZTWYi4227m
transaction
7b8c6b500aebc20254d9fc1a504d672e01046bf9893ca9da6d9e8f99a4017d3f
spent
true